Stonehenge is a prehistoric megalithic structure and tourist attraction in South West England.

History[edit]

"Stonehenge" has been used a disparaging epithet by Homer to Charles Heathbar and Moe to Neil Gaiman as both Charles Heathbar and Neil Gaiman were Englishmen.[1][2]

In the third level of The Simpsons Game, Homer has to destroy Stonehenge at one point in order to progress through the level.
